Network Engineer - Cisco & ThousandEyes Implementation
Job Title: Network Engineer - Cisco & ThousandEyes Implementation
Contract: 6-Month Contract (Inside IR35)
Location: London (Onsite 3 Days per Week)
Rate: £400 per day (Inside IR35)
Start Date: ASAP
Job Description:
We are seeking an experienced Network Engineer with proven expertise in Cisco networking technologies and hands-on experience implementing Cisco ThousandEyes. This is a key role supporting a complex enterprise network environment, working closely with cross-functional teams including Unified Communications (UC), Security, and Infrastructure.
This is a 6-month contract role, based onsite in London 3 days per week, with a daily rate of £400 (Inside IR35).
Key Responsibilities:
-
Architect and implement Cisco ThousandEyes monitoring and visibility solutions.
-
Manage and support a robust enterprise network with a strong focus on routing, switching, and wireless (Cisco WiFi).
-
Provide support for network-related aspects of Microsoft Teams and Cisco telephony systems, including QoS tuning and circuit capacity planning.
-
Work collaboratively with the UC team to troubleshoot and resolve voice/video network performance issues.
-
Administer and support Cisco and Checkpoint Firewalls, including Firewall policy management.
-
Support network automation initiatives using tools such as Ansible.
-
Participate in the design and delivery of Cisco SD-WAN, SD-Access, Catalyst Center, and ISE projects.
-
Provide advanced support for network diagnostics, monitoring, and analytics tools.
Required Skills & Experience:
-
Proven experience in a Network Engineer role with core competencies in Routing & Switching.
-
Strong knowledge of networking protocols such as QoS, BGP, OSPF, HSRP, IPSEC, 802.11, 802.1x.
-
Hands-on experience implementing and managing Cisco ThousandEyes.
-
Solid experience with Cisco technologies: Switches, Routers, wireless, Catalyst Center, ISE, and Firewalls.
-
Experience working with Cisco and Checkpoint Firewalls.
-
Strong understanding of network monitoring, diagnostics, and troubleshooting tools.
-
Exposure to or experience with Cisco SD-WAN, SD-Access, and automation/configuration tools such as Ansible.
-
Knowledge of network Firewall policy administration is a plus.
-
Strong communication skills and the ability to work cross-functionally with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Qualifications:
-
Degree in Computer Science or a related field.
-
Professional certifications such as CCNA, CCNP or equivalent are preferred.
